Main Purpose of Job
POSITION DUTIES
Monitor and communicate with MSP and other public safety personnel via two-way multi-channel radios and maintain required documentation of same.
Utilize METERS/NCIC/NLETS to obtain, update, disseminate and accurately transmit information within the Department and to other law enforcement and criminal justice agencies.
Utilize telephones in a professional manner to provide necessary guidance and information to Department personnel and the general public.
File and maintain METERS/NLETS messages, and various required logs associated with the communications center operation.
Interact with Department personnel, allied agencies and the general public.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education: Graduation from a standard high school or possession of a State high school equivalence certificate.
Experience: None
Note: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a non-commissioned officer in Operations Specialist classifications or Signal Corps, Cyberspace Support, or Communications specialty codes in the communications field of work on a year-for-year basis for the required experience.
